随笔分类 - mysql进阶

1

摘要:防御SQL注入的方法总结 这篇文章主要讲解了防御SQL注入的方法,介绍了什么是注入,注入的原因是什么,以及如何防御,需要的朋友可以参考下。 SQL注入是一类危害极大的攻击形式。虽然危害很大,但是防御却远远没有XSS那么困难。 SQL注入可以参见:https://en.wikipedia.org/wi

阅读全文

posted @ 2018-01-21 16:37

云潇洒

阅读(765)

评论(0)

推荐(0) 编辑

摘要:CPU超负荷异常情况 问题 项目部署阶段,提交订单时总是出现cpu超负荷工作情况,导致机器卡死,订单提交失败。通过任务管理器可见下图所示: 通过任务管理器中进程信息(见下图)进行查看,可见正是由于项目运行的原因导致CPU超负荷工作。元凶究竟是谁?难道是因为输出的测试语句太多导致的,尝试减少测试输出语

阅读全文

posted @ 2018-01-21 16:36

云潇洒

阅读(283)

评论(0)

推荐(0) 编辑

摘要:SQL语句如何精准查找某一时间段的数据 在项目开发过程中,自己需要查询出一定时间段内的交易。故需要在sql查询语句中加入日期时间要素,sql语句如何实现? SELECT * FROM lmapp.lm_bill where tx_time Between '2015-12-20' And '2015

阅读全文

posted @ 2018-01-21 16:34

云潇洒

阅读(31172)

评论(0)

推荐(0) 编辑

摘要:完全卸载mysql数据库图文教程 有时候MySQL不能完全卸载,这时候必须通过一些途径删除掉注册表和一些残余的文件,然后才能重新安装才可以成功! 方法/步骤 1.控制面板——》所有控制面板项——》程序和功能,卸载mysql server! 2.然后删除mysql文件夹下的my.ini文件及所有文件

阅读全文

posted @ 2018-01-21 16:33

云潇洒

阅读(189)

评论(0)

推荐(0) 编辑

摘要:Cannot Connect to Database Server 缘由 由于不同的项目中使用的数据库用户名与密码出现了不一致的情况,在其中之前较早一个项目执行过程中出现“The user specified as a definer ('root'@'localhost') does not ex

阅读全文

posted @ 2018-01-21 16:32

云潇洒

阅读(7084)

评论(0)

推荐(0) 编辑

摘要:mysql进阶(十六)常见问题汇总 MySQL视图学习: http://www.itokit.com/2011/0908/67848.html 执行删除操作时,出现如下错误提示: 出现以上问题的原因是:在数据库中涉及到主外键的操作,删除时应对其进行级联删除的设置。如下图所示: 在做删除视图中数据操作

阅读全文

posted @ 2018-01-21 16:31

云潇洒

阅读(276)

评论(0)

推荐(0) 编辑

摘要:假设有一个表(syslogs)有1000万条记录,需要在业务不停止的情况下删除其中statusid=1的所有记录,差不多有600万条, 直接执行 DELETE FROM syslogs WHERE statusid=1 会发现删除失败,因为lock wait timeout exceed的错误。 因

阅读全文

posted @ 2018-01-21 16:30

云潇洒

阅读(38030)

评论(2)

推荐(0) 编辑

摘要:MySQL命令行导出导入数据库 M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d D:\Program Files\MySQL\MySQL Server 5.5\bin (或者直接将windows的环境变量path中

阅读全文

posted @ 2018-01-21 16:29

云潇洒

阅读(22168)

评论(0)

推荐(0) 编辑

摘要:mysql 批量更新与批量更新多条记录的不同值实现方法 在mysql中批量更新我们可能使用update,replace into来操作,下面详细介绍mysql批量更新与性能。 批量更新 mysql更新语句很简单,更新一条数据的某个字段,一般这样写: UPDATE mytable SET myfiel

阅读全文

posted @ 2018-01-21 16:29

云潇洒

阅读(2222)

评论(0)

推荐(0) 编辑

摘要:MySQL外键在数据库中的作用 MySQL外键的目的是控制存储在外键表中的数据,使两张表形成关联,是MySQL数据库中非常重要的组成部分,值得我们去深入了解。那么,MySQL外键究竟起到哪些作用呢?下文就将带您一探其中的秘密。 MySQL外键的作用 保持数据一致性,完整性,主要目的是控制存储在外键表

阅读全文

posted @ 2018-01-21 16:27

云潇洒

阅读(150)

评论(0)

推荐(0) 编辑

摘要:今天在设计数据表时,突然发现原来FLOAT原来是很不靠谱的,所以在这里建议大家换成DOUBLE类型, 原因是: 在mysql手册中讲到,在MySQL中的所有计算都是使用双精度完成的,使用float(单精度)会有误差,出现意想不到的结果。 在我们查询数据时,MySQL使用64位十进制数值的精度执行DE

阅读全文

posted @ 2018-01-21 16:26

云潇洒

阅读(138)

评论(0)

推荐(0) 编辑

摘要:MySQL多表查询 一 使用SELECT子句进行多表查询 SELECT 字段名 FROM 表1,表2 … WHERE 表1.字段 = 表2.字段 AND 其它查询条件 SELECT a.id,a.name,a.address,a.date,b.math,b.english,b.chinese FRO

阅读全文

posted @ 2018-01-21 16:25

云潇洒

阅读(775)

评论(0)

推荐(0) 编辑

摘要:MySQL中怎么对varchar类型排序问题 asc 升级 desc降序 在mysql默认order by 只对数字与日期类型可以排序,但对于varchar字符型类型排序好像没有用了,下面我来给各位同学介绍varchar类型排序问题如何解决。 今天在对国家电话号码表进行排序的时候发现了一个有趣的问题

阅读全文

posted @ 2018-01-21 16:24

云潇洒

阅读(285)

评论(0)

推荐(0) 编辑

摘要:limit是mysql的语法 select * from table limit m,n 其中m是指记录开始的index,从0开始,表示第一条记录 n是指从第m+1条开始,取n条。 select * from tablename limit 2,4 即取出第3条至第6条,4条记录。

阅读全文

posted @ 2018-01-21 16:21

云潇洒

阅读(140)

评论(0)

推荐(0) 编辑

摘要:mysql中模糊查询的四种用法介绍 这篇文章主要介绍了mysql中模糊查询的四种用法,需要的朋友可以参考下。 下面介绍mysql中模糊查询的四种用法: 1 %: 表示任意0个或多个字符。可匹配任意类型和长度的字符,有些情况下若是中文,请使用两个百分号(%%)表示。 比如 SELECT * FROM

阅读全文

posted @ 2018-01-21 16:20

云潇洒

阅读(164)

评论(0)

推荐(0) 编辑

摘要:MySQL数据表中带OR的多条件查询 OR关键字可以联合多个条件进行查询。使用OR关键字时: 条件 1) 只要符合这几个查询条件的其中一个条件,这样的记录就会被查询出来。 2) 如果不符合这些查询条件中的任何一条,这样的记录将被排除掉。 语法格式 OR关键字的基本语法格式如下: 条件表达式1 OR

阅读全文

posted @ 2018-01-21 16:19

云潇洒

阅读(195)

评论(0)

推荐(0) 编辑

摘要:mysql中select * for update 注: FOR UPDATE 仅适用于InnoDB,且必须在事务区块(BEGIN/COMMIT)中才能生效。 作用 锁定该语句所选择到的对象。防止在选择之后别的地方修改这些对象造成数据不一致。要保证在统计(查询)执行过程中,记录不被其他用户更新, 则

阅读全文

posted @ 2018-01-21 16:18

云潇洒

阅读(896)

评论(0)

推荐(0) 编辑

摘要:mysql游标简易教程 从mysql V5.5开始,进行了一次大的改变,就是将InnoDB作为默认的存储引擎。InnoDB支持事务,而且拥有相关的RDBMS特性:ACID事务支持,数据完整性(支持外键),灾难恢复能力等等。 现在简单总结一下游标的知识。 (一)认识游标(cursor) 游标简单来说就

阅读全文

posted @ 2018-01-21 16:17

云潇洒

阅读(261)

评论(0)

推荐(0) 编辑

摘要:Mysql索引简易教程 基本概念 索引是指把你设置为索引的字段A的内容储存在一个独立区间S里,里面只有这个字段的内容。在找查这个与这个字段A的内容时会直接从这个独立区间里查找,而不是去到数据表里查找。找到的这些符合条件的字段后再读取字段A所指向真实的数据记录的物理地址,再把对应的数据内容输出。如果你

阅读全文

posted @ 2018-01-21 16:16

云潇洒

阅读(166)

评论(0)

推荐(0) 编辑

摘要:1.什么是外键: 主键:是唯一标识一条记录,不能有重复的,不允许为空,用来保证数据完整性 外键:是另一表的主键, 外键可以有重复的, 可以是空值,用来和其他表建立联系用的。所以说,如果谈到了外键,一定是至少涉及到两张表。例如下面这两张表: 上面有两张表:部门表(dept)、员工表(emp)。Id=D

阅读全文

posted @ 2018-01-21 16:15

云潇洒

阅读(185)

评论(0)

推荐(0) 编辑

1

Powered by:

博客园

Copyright © 2021 云潇洒

Powered by .NET 5.0 on Kubernetes

mysql 进阶_mysql进阶 - 随笔分类 - 云潇洒 - 博客园相关推荐

  1. 详细分析MySQL的日志(一)本文原创地址:博客园骏马金龙https://www.cnblogs.com/f-ck-need-u/p/9001061.html

    本文原创地址:博客园骏马金龙https://www.cnblogs.com/f-ck-need-u/p/9001061.html 官方手册:https://dev.mysql.com/doc/refm ...

  2. mysql可以做决策树吗_决策树 - stream886 - 博客园

    参考资料 决策树 决策树是一种运用概率与图论中的树对决策中的不同方案进行比较,从而获得最优方案的风险型决策方法. 决策树学习三步骤: 特征选择 决策树的生成 决策树的剪枝 常用的决策树算法有ID3,C ...

  3. mysql与串口通信_串口通信 - ShawnXie - 博客园

    1.并行通信 2.串口通信 (1)同步通信(synchronous data communication,SYNC) 指在约定的通信速率下,发送端和接收端的时钟信号频率和相位始终保持一致(同步),保证 ...

  4. 我的Android进阶之旅:经典的大牛博客推荐

    Android中文Wiki AndroidStudio-NDK开发-移动开发团队 谦虚的天下 - 博客园 gundumw100博客 - android进阶分类文章列表 - ITeye技术网站 CSDN ...

  5. Android进阶之旅:经典的大牛博客推荐

    Android中文Wiki AndroidStudio-NDK开发-移动开发团队 谦虚的天下 - 博客园 gundumw100博客 - android进阶分类文章列表 - ITeye技术网站 CSDN ...

  6. 搭建云mysql,基于ECS搭建云上博客

    安装 Apache HTTP 服务 Apache是世界使用排名第一的Web服务器软件.它可以运行在几乎所有广泛使用的计算机平台上,由于其跨平台和安全性被广泛使用,是最流行的Web服务器端软件之一. 1 ...

  7. 基于阿里云ECS搭建云上博客!超详细图文步骤!

    阿里云体验 地址:https://developer.aliyun.com/adc/scenario/410e5b6a852f4b4b88bf74bf4c197a57?spm=a2c6h.150139 ...

  8. python3进阶开发-第一个仿博客园的项目(1)

    首先我们要设计一下表结构: UserInfo(用户信息表) -------->一对一    ----------->Blog(博客信息表) UserInfo(用户信息表) -------- ...

  9. 微信小程序云开发博客系统源代码,让写博客像发朋友圈一样简单,含使用部署教程

    博客就两种:一是随笔,记录自己的成长历程,二是有目的的发文,例如搬运各种网赚文,我想大部分朋友做博客的初衷都是有一块自己的心灵净土,于是催生了wxapp-blog这款小程序. 完整代码下载地址:微信小 ...

最新文章

  1. No module named ‘jieba‘ python3.7
  2. centos apache php mysql zend_CentOS 5.5搭建Apache+PHP5.2x+MySQL5+Zend3(yum安装)
  3. 中级php开发面试,PHP中级工程师面试题(二)
  4. Oracle 数据库用户锁定与解锁,用户锁定最大密码失败次数设置方法,ORA-28000: the account is locked问题解决方法
  5. 月入过万的副业你要不要?不需要编程知识,不限男女,不限学历
  6. android8.0及发布时间,android 8.0什么时候发布_android 8.0发布时间_android 8.0新特性
  7. ScintillaNET的应用
  8. Hive 大数据表性能调优
  9. markdown mysql高亮_博客园里Markdown支持高亮显示的语言
  10. break continue区别和用法_[分享]Python专题之流程控制(进阶用法2)
  11. python2.7没有pip_python2.7无法使用pip怎么办
  12. 上海交通大学出版社python教材答案学生信息管理系统_学生信息管理系统任务书...
  13. 乾颐堂安德最新HCNP真题讲解含2017年最新变题后题库,75到90题
  14. usb_modeswitch下载与安装
  15. Google Chrome谷歌浏览器清除缓存以及清除Cookie快捷键
  16. 城市级智能网联示范区情况全扫描
  17. 科普:什么是CPU?CPU和芯片关系?CPU怎么做的?CPU有什么用?不同CPU有什么区别?我们怎么选CPU?(待补充完整)
  18. CapstoneCS5211,CS5212,CS5256,CS5811,CS5288,……型号大全
  19. 趋势判研:基于Web3.0的智能生态体——保险科技生态建设...
  20. bootstrap table表格点击行checkbox勾选或取消勾选

热门文章

  1. Linux系统开机出现 “welcome to emergency mode!”已解决
  2. 《Python小游戏汇总》- 1. 表白神器
  3. nn.Sequential nn.ModuleList
  4. 国行版本搭载鸿蒙os,华为Watch GT 2 Pro 国行版将搭载鸿蒙OS
  5. 对话连心医疗章桦:如何用AI云服务改变肿瘤治疗行业 | AI英雄
  6. Editplus5.0 注册码
  7. 如何科学跑步 - 刨析
  8. 思念是一种病(转载)
  9. 无U盘升级win10专业版
  10. 软件测试修炼之道(转载)